Genotyping Staphylococcus epidermidis isolated from mastitis in goats

To verify the dynamics of antimicrobial resistance in a property in Santa Maria da Boa Vista city - Pernambuco were evaluated 14 Staphylococcus epidermidis isolates from goats with subclinical mastitis. The profile of antimicrobial resistance was determined by disk diffusion test. The genotyping was performed using the marker REP (Repetitive Extragenic Palindromic) - PCR, using RW3A primer, where the degrees of similarity and clustering phenogram were established by means of the Sorensen-Dice coefficient (SD) algorithm UPGMA, program NTSYS-pc, which allowed the identification of 4 patterns of 14 S. epidermidis isolates, being eight in the profile A, four in a profile B, one in profile C and one in profile D. For all groups to penicillin resistance was observed, while for groups A and C this was associated with lincomycin, for group B this was associated with tetracycline.
